  • Patent number: 7047703
    Abstract: A building strut is formed as a cylinder having a plurality of contiguous sidewalls. Opposing terminal ends of the sidewalls define the ends of the cylinder. One or more of the sidewall ends are formed as a coiled spiral. These spirals may be formed within one of the ends of the cylinder or lateral to the cylinder's end and thus provide extreme strength to the end of the cylinder. The ends of the sidewalls that are not coiled may terminate adjacent to the coiled sidewall or may extend axially beyond it, and they may be separated to form independent ears, or they may maintain their mutual integrity. If the ears are separate, they may be bent outwardly lateral to the cylinder, or at an angle to it, to facilitate joining to other structural members.

  • Publication number: 20020116891
    Abstract: A strut apparatus for constructive use in the building framing arts is comprised of an elongate sheet-metal first cylinder, open at each of its ends, one of the ends providing a pair of integral ears. An elongate sheet-metal second cylinder is also open at each of its ends, and also provides attachment ears. The first and second cylinders are adapted by size and shape for tight sliding mutual engagement in a coaxial, linearly extensible, relationship with the ears of each of the cylinders extending in opposite directions.

  • Publication number: 20020116893
    Abstract: A building strut of rectangular cylindrical construction has four contiguous, axially directed side walls. A terminal end of one or two of the four side walls is rolled into a coiled, retracted position, exposing interior surfaces of the remaining adjacent side wall terminal ends. These remaining terminal ends of the building strut are then be formed into jogged-out positions for receiving a second building strut in permanent engagement medially or at its end.

  • Patent number: 6378349
    Abstract: A sheet metal cutting and forming tool is used in preparing the ends of square sheet metal tubes used in building construction as framing struts and studs. The tool receives a tube end axially wherein four cutting edges sever the tube at its four corners. Two opposing curved surfaces force two corresponding opposing sides of the tubing to roll up inside the tube, while two alternate curved surfaces force the alternate corresponding opposing sides to move outwardly into slots or onto laterally oriented guide surfaces. The resultant tube end provides opposing and axially or laterally extending sides spaced apart for receiving a second tube of the same size wherein the alternate sides may be fastened to the second tube sidewall while the rolled-up ends provide great rigidity, or alternately the lateral tube ends are easily fastened to a wall or similar surface.

  • Patent number: 6272807
    Abstract: A plurality of roof panels are used for covering a pitched roof. The roof panels are of a structural sheet metal, positioned and laid over the roof and provide a series of spaced apart longitudinal stiffening steps separated by at least one flat surface portion adapted for abutting the roof for enablement of attachment thereto. The top edge of each panel is convex and coved for use in covering a peak of the roof. A step is provided near the bottom edge of each panel for covering the covered top edge of a further one of the panels laid below it.
